Dichloromethane (DCM, methylene chloride, or methylene bichloride) is an organochlorine compound with the formula C H 2 Cl 2. This colorless, volatile liquid with a chloroform -like, sweet odor is widely used as a solvent .
Kidney function gradually decreases as someone ages. The elderly are also likely to be underweight. In addition, these older people tend to be dehydrated and be taking other medications. These factors increase the likelihood of developing side effects of digoxin and digoxin toxicity. Often lowering the dose is considered by the prescriber. [6]

Type A: augmented pharmacological effects, which are dose-dependent and predictable [5]; Type A reactions, which constitute approximately 80% of adverse drug reactions, are usually a consequence of the drug's primary pharmacological effect (e.g., bleeding when using the anticoagulant warfarin) or a low therapeutic index of the drug (e.g., nausea from digoxin), and they are therefore predictable.

Like most other general anesthetics and sedative-hypnotic drugs, chloroform is a positive allosteric modulator at GABA A receptors. [74] Chloroform causes depression of the central nervous system (CNS), ultimately producing deep coma and respiratory center depression.
